Can i do my own pool maintenance?

Maintaining a swimming pool yourself can cost you less. However, in the event of problems such as leaks, broken pumps or turbid water, it is advisable to hire a pool cleaning service provider. They have the tools and experience to solve problems efficiently. In some cases, it may be useful to maintain the pool yourself. If you have pool cleaning experience, have the right equipment and tools, are familiar with pool chemical management, and have enough free time to dedicate to it, pool maintenance is a job you can probably do.

Although time consuming, work itself can certainly save you money in the long run. However, replacing outdated or broken equipment can be costly, and some repairs may prove to be more than you can handle on your own. Fly over, brush and vacuum your pool at least weekly. This keeps debris out of your water and leaves your walls spotlessly clean.

Baking soda paste works particularly well as a simple scouring cleaner that won’t damage delicate tiles or a vinyl lining when brushing.
